[Cu(II) complexes with biomacromolecules. The use of Cu(II) ions as a structural spin label]
Biofizika
|January 1, 1997
Abstract:
Complexes of Cu(II) ions with globular proteins (human serum albumin, bovine serum albumin, egg albumin, lisozim and DNA) have been studied using the ESR method. It was shown that Cu(II) ions may be use as structural "spin-label" to study conformational dynamics of macromolecules, including structural transition in biopolymers.
